Eli Lilly's deal with Innovent outsources R&D through Phase 2 to China. This leverages China's faster clinical development environment, allowing Lilly to de-risk assets before committing to costly global trials, effectively creating an externalized early-stage pipeline.
Western pharma firms strategically license assets from Chinese biotechs while leaving China rights with the local partner. This leverages China's faster, cheaper clinical development, as the partner tests the molecule in new indications, generating valuable data that de-risks the asset for the global firm at no extra cost.
Through a strategic collaboration with PreGene, Kite Pharma is leveraging China's distinct regulatory landscape. This partnership allows them to test and iterate on new in vivo cell therapy constructs more rapidly than is possible in Western markets, creating a significant competitive R&D advantage in a fast-moving field.

Through massive government investment in biotech infrastructure, China has become the global hub for early-stage clinical drug development. Both Chinese and Western companies now conduct initial human trials there to move much faster and at a significantly lower cost, giving China a strategic foothold in the pharma value chain.
China's biotech infrastructure enables companies to move from discovery to initial human proof-of-concept in under two years for less than $2 million per molecule. This rapid, low-cost development, particularly in new modalities like RNAi, presents a significant competitive threat that many Western innovators underestimate.
China's ability to accelerate biotech development stems from faster patient recruitment for clinical trials. With a large, treatment-naive patient population willing to participate in studies, early-stage oncology trials can be completed in about half the time it takes in the US. This provides a significant strategic advantage for de-risking assets more quickly and cheaply.
Driven by significant government investment, China is rapidly becoming a leader in biotech R&D, licensing, and outsourcing. This shift is a top-of-mind concern for US biotech and pharma executives, with China now involved in a majority of top R&D licensing deals.
In a major strategic shift, large pharmaceutical companies are increasingly sourcing their M&A pipeline from China. Chinese assets now account for 30-40% of Big Pharma's early-stage acquisitions, up from single digits just a few years ago, primarily because they are significantly cheaper than US or European equivalents.
Pharmaceutical companies are engaging in lengthy negotiations with US biotech startups while simultaneously exploring cheaper, faster assets in China. This creates negotiation leverage and puts downward pressure on valuations and deal terms for US-based innovators.
The next decade in biotech will prioritize speed and cost, areas where Chinese companies excel. They rapidly and cheaply advance molecules to early clinical trials, attracting major pharma companies to acquire assets that they historically would have sourced from US biotechs. This is reshaping the global competitive landscape.
